Guardian of the Land is a short film where cultural and community leaders of Nch'i-Wána (or Columbia River) tribes share perspectives and oral histories on America's most famous cryptid-Bigfoot, as a spiritual being that teaches one to enter into a relationship with the land.

"AWAKENING" is a short film about an elderly woman (Louise Katchia) who hopes to restore her assimilated grandson's connection to their culture. Nathan (Solomon Trimble) is unwillingly sent to see a Shaman (Foster Kalama) in the cold backwoods of the Warm Springs Indian reservation. Immediately placed into a ceremony circle, Nathan is put into a trance on a spiritual quest to face his inner Native American as his modern self. Facing the unknown, Nathan overcomes his fear in an ultimate test of survival, fighting a violent cultural force within. Ultimately defeating the unknown, he becomes the inner Native American and restores his connection to his culture and faith.
